About the role
The CB Insights Senior Strategic Account Manager is responsible for managing and growing a portfolio of our highest-value enterprise accounts, including leading corporations, investors, and consultancies shaping global industries. This role blends relationship stewardship with a growth mindset: cultivating platform adoption and advocacy while identifying and driving expansion opportunities across divisions, geographies, and new use cases. You’ll operate as a trusted advisor to senior stakeholders and economic buyers, articulating ROI and strategic impact while uncovering new opportunities to embed CB Insights deeper into their workflows through our platform, data solutions, and APIs.
Responsibilities
- Own and grow a portfolio of strategic accounts, driving both retention and expansion through proactive account planning and consultative engagement.
- Partner with senior stakeholders and economic buyers to demonstrate clear ROI, link insights to business outcomes, and influence long-term strategy.
- Collaborate with SDRs to identify and pursue new opportunities, referrals, and whitespace within enterprise clients.
- Sell and expand data solutions, including API integrations, data feeds, and workflow-based solutions.
- Develop and execute Strategic Account Plans, including mapping key stakeholders, setting growth goals, and tracking engagement and adoption.
- Run renewal and expansion cycles end-to-end, including negotiations, pricing discussions, and contract execution.
- Leverage data and analytics to anticipate risk, spot growth potential, and drive proactive engagement.
- Serve as a thought partner to clients, offering insights on emerging technologies, market shifts, and innovation trends.
- Continuously improve account management processes and share best practices across the Strategic Account Management team.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in business, economics, finance, or related field.
- At least 5 years of experience in enterprise account management, customer success, or consultative sales, ideally in SaaS or data/insights-driven businesses.
- Proven track record of retaining and expanding large enterprise accounts, with comfort in both farming and hunting motions.
- Experience managing executive-level relationships and navigating complex organizations.
- Strong commercial and negotiation skills, with ability to align value with business outcomes.
- Familiarity with data integrations, APIs, and data feed solutions.
- Expertise using CRMs (Salesforce preferred), Excel, and BI tools to track performance and communicate insights.
- Excellent communication and presentation skills; capable of influencing at senior levels.
- Highly intellectually curious, adaptable, and self-driven with a strong growth mindset.
